We haven’t had any music for a long time. Last night in bed I had the radio playing a French station, very softly, when this old song came on. I’d never translated it for myself, so I have translated it for all of us. It’s not a word for word translation — those never work and especially not for poetry or songs– but my best effort to provide the sense of the lyrics. Spagna can sing also in English, but not this song.


Ivana Spagna

This still shot is recent. Ms Spagna has not yet seen a reason to alter her look, although she’s 54 years old now. When I hear her interviewed, she seems such a nice person that I do wish I didn’t feel so uneasy about this “branding” like the ancient Elvis. Let us not quibble, however, about her big, emotion-packed voice and the songs she wrote for it.

People Like Us

How many times words are said
That you would take back immediately
And how many barriers hide and never fall
Hurting the one who loves us like you have done?

How many times too the greatest loves
Suffer the price of these errors
And how many times you lose yourself this way
In stupid anger and then find yourself alone.

People like us who don’t stay together anymore
But who like us still love
Unique loves, but so fragile
True and endless love stories.

It’s so hard to forgive
One who has made you cry and feel bad
But there’s only one life and I’d want it with you
With all its problems, everything there is.

People like us who don’t stay together anymore
But who like us still love
Unique loves, but so fragile
True and endless love stories.

To everyone who believes in love
But often like us are lonely people
In the heart embrace memories and shivers
People like us who still dream.

The drifting apart is worse than an sickness
If you love someone who isn’t there
In the name of love don’t throw it away
Someone will die if they don’t find you again.

People like us who don’t stay together anymore
But who like us still love
Unique loves, but so fragile
True and endless love stories.
